Abstract

Ready Mixed Concrete (RMC) plays the vital role in construction projects. The productivity of the concreting activities in construction mainly depends on the delivery of Ready Mixed Concrete from the Concrete Batching Plant (CBP) for the constructions using purchased concrete. The Ready Mixed Concrete production industry is very competitive and Concreting Batching Plant management has to ensure that their products are delivered to site on time with maximum economy. Ready Mixed Concrete Delivered to the construction site was a function of operations of both Concreting Batching Plant and Transit Mixer(TM). The Ready Mixed Concrete Plant contains the variables such as Concrete Type, Distance to Site from Plant, Pump Capacity, Truck Load, Time of Transportation, Proximity to City and the Output variables are Loading Time, Hauling Time, Unloading Time, and Cycle Time. The relationships between these variables and cycle time are analyzed using SPSS tool. The statistical analyses carried out are Measurement of central tendency, correlation coefficient, and t-test analysis shows that the main factor affecting the cycle time is Distance.
